Few people have actually the expertise needed to control every type of parasite in every scenario. How do you discover a good insect management company? And when you have one, just how can you inform if their solution is suitable? Some pest monitoring companies advertise their firm's longevity. Being in service for 50 years does not necessarily suggest the firm will handle your bugs properly.


Also, you need to thoroughly consider any type of references a company supplies. Practically every company contends the very least a few pleased consumers. It's far better to financial institution on independent recommendations from friends or associates that have acquired the company's solution. You additionally might intend to check out any problems against the business, filed at your regional Better Service Bureau or Consumer Protection Office of the Attorney General Of The United States.


A lot of pest administration companies use cost-free inspections. A well-informed and knowledgeable examiner can give you with beneficial information, not just regarding insects, yet about your home and what you can do to prevent pest problem.

You'll most likely discover a whole lot, not only about parasite management, but also about the high quality of each firm's personnel and how it operates. This first in-person call with a possible company, is extremely vital. Consider it as a doctor's residence phone call, but likewise as a task meeting. Do not be reluctant to ask concerns.


How long do you assume it will take to fix my parasite issues? Does the company use a warranty? Did the service information seem vague or common, or specifically designed to solve your parasite problems?


Was the inspector on time? Did he/she show up specialist? The first thing that influences most consumers choosing on a parasite management business is cost.

It could be the very best worth. However cost must never be the primary factor regulating your choice. A low-cost business may not be billing you sufficient to cover the price of using the most effective products or of costs adequate time to finish the job. On the other hand, a business quoting a relatively high rate may be overcharging for their solutions.

IPM is Integrated Pest Management, the fundamental facility of pest control. Its goal is not to decrease or eliminate the usage of pesticides. The objective of IPM is to control pests; by utilizing the very best control methods after carefully considering each technique's security, performance, price, and effect on non-target organisms and the atmosphere.


This used to be the basic method of parasite management service technicians however it is normally inefficient and pop over here unnecessarily reveals individuals and family pets to pesticide. Insects periodically live behind walls, hardly ever inside them, however never ever on them. So seldom is there a need to spray baseboards. If pesticides are to be applied, they should be related to the splits, crevices and voids where insects invest many of their time.

When the professional's evaluation finds evidence of a bug issue, he/she should establish the most effective techniques to use, after that apply those techniques. That relies on your scenario and the sort of bug included. Some pests can be regulated by a solitary service. Others might take months, and even much longer. When your insect troubles are eliminated, you may decide to preserve regular solution, but that solution needs to concentrate on evaluation and place treatment of parasites if and where they are uncovered, instead of regular pesticide application.


Lots of others can be handled by utilizing just pesticides with less toxic active ingredients and formulas such as lures, dusts, and microencapsulate pesticides that provide much less danger of human direct exposure. No chemical substance is definitely safe. The United State Environmental Protection Company (EPA) registers all pesticides, after analyzing that each presents tolerable risk when used according to label instructions.


In basic it is the misuse, not making use of pesticides that is dangerous. The EPA acknowledges that risks connected with chemical direct exposure may be greater for expectant women, kids and infants, and takes this right into account when registering pesticides. If you're concerned regarding these dangers, have your doctor review the labels of pesticides that will certainly be used in your home.
